What Is a Healthcare Discount Plan?
A healthcare discount plan is not insurance. And it doesn’t pretend to be.
Instead of reimbursing care later, it offers immediate, upfront savings on healthcare services through a network of participating providers.

Healthcare Discount Plan vs Insurance: The Real Differences
Here’s what this comparison looks like in real life.
Cost Structure
Insurance requires monthly premiums whether employees use it or not.
Rubicare costs $79 per year per employee.
That’s predictable. Budget-friendly. And easy to explain.
Access to Care
With insurance, employees often delay care because they’re unsure what’s covered or worried about surprise bills.
With a healthcare discount plan, the savings are clear. Employees know what they’ll save before they book the appointment.
And they can use it immediately.
